A stye is a painful red bump on your eyelid edge. Similar to an acne pimple, a stye forms when a tiny oil gland near the eyelashes becomes blocked and gets infected. …

The entire eyelid rarely swells and they are usually not painful. If it is large enough, it can press on the eyeball and cause blurry vision. They are usually caused by a clogged oil gland. Chalazions, however, are not active infections. motorized bicycle break in periodWeb12 de nov. de 2024 · Treatment often involves using warm compresses for 15 minutes at a time four times per day to soften the stye and help it drain.
